Preview

Peschiera Maraglio, Monte Isola, the largest lake island in Europe, Province of Brescia, Lombardy, Italy, Europe
Peschiera Maraglio, Monte Isola, the largest lake island in Europe, Province of Brescia, Lombardy, Italy, Europe
Image ID: 1299-41
Artist: Michele Rossetti
Purchase a commercial license Buy framed prints & more from our print store